As we journey through life, maturity and self-awareness are qualities we often strive for. Yet, it’s fascinating how some people, regardless of their age, seem to miss the mark. I’ve noticed that certain phrases can be telltale signs of this lack of growth. Here are 15 phrases that might just reveal someone’s need for a little more introspection.

1. “Not my problem.”

This one hits hard. When someone says this, it feels like a wall goes up. It shows a lack of empathy and responsibility. Mature people understand that helping others is part of being human. Those who brush off others’ concerns might be missing out on valuable connections and opportunities for personal growth.

2. “I’m just being real; if they can’t handle it, that’s their problem.”

I get it—honesty is important. But this phrase often masks a lack of compassion. It’s easy to think we’re being authentic when we’re really just being blunt. True maturity means considering how our words affect others. It’s about fostering understanding, not just sharing our unfiltered thoughts.

3. “Get over it.”

This phrase can be incredibly dismissive. It’s like telling someone to turn off their emotions with a flick of a switch. The truth is, feelings are complex and don’t just vanish. Those who say this might not realize how harsh it sounds, and they miss the chance to truly connect with someone in need.

4. “I don’t see why I should apologize.”

This phrase reflects a struggle with accountability. It’s as if they’re saying, “I’m not the problem here.” But life is rarely that clear-cut. Mature individuals know that a sincere apology can heal wounds and bridge gaps. It’s not about being right or wrong; it’s about acknowledging our shared humanity.

5. “If they can’t take a joke, that’s on them.”

Humor can be tricky, right? This phrase often signals a lack of self-reflection. It’s essential to recognize that what’s funny to one person might be hurtful to another. Mature individuals take responsibility for their words, even when joking, and they’re open to understanding why someone might feel hurt.

6. “I’m not responsible for how others feel.”

While it’s true we can’t control others’ feelings, this phrase reveals a disconnect from emotional intelligence. We all play a part in how our words and actions impact those around us. Mature people recognize this and strive to be more mindful in their interactions.

7. “I don’t have to explain myself to you.”

When someone says this, it feels like they’re shutting down a conversation before it even starts. It’s frustrating for those trying to engage with them. This phrase shows a reluctance to share and consider other perspectives, which can hinder personal growth.

8. “It’s my way or the highway.”

This phrase screams inflexibility! People who say this struggle with teamwork and compromise, which means they miss out on great opportunities to learn and grow. Mature individuals appreciate different perspectives and are open to adjusting their approach based on feedback.

9. “You always/never.”

Using absolutes like “You always” or “You never” can be damaging. These phrases oversimplify complex situations and ignore the nuances of human behavior. They can hurt relationships and leave little room for growth. It’s important to embrace the grey areas in our interactions.

10. “I already knew that.”

This phrase often comes off as dismissive. Those who frequently say this may be trying to project knowledge, but they’re missing the chance to learn something new. Knowledge should be a shared experience, not a competition. Every perspective has value.

11. “Why does this always happen to me?”

This phrase reflects a victim mentality. It shows a struggle to take responsibility for one’s actions and the outcomes that follow. Instead of learning from experiences, they often attribute their misfortunes to external factors. It’s a mindset that can hold them back from growth.

12. “You’re just jealous.”

This phrase often comes up in heated moments. When someone says, “You’re just jealous,” they’re trying to brush off valid concerns. It’s a classic way to deflect! Instead of addressing the issue, they’re shifting blame. This immature response doesn’t help anyone and shows they might not be ready to accept constructive feedback.

13. “I’m the victim here.”

Constantly framing oneself as a victim shows a lack of personal responsibility. While real victimization happens, habitually saying this can indicate a refusal to acknowledge one’s role in situations. It can also be a way to manipulate others into feeling sorry for them. Mature individuals focus on solutions rather than blame.

14. “You can’t tell me what to do.”

This phrase comes up when someone feels their independence is threatened. It’s an immediate reaction that shows a lack of maturity. Mature individuals understand that sometimes, taking advice or following directions is necessary for growth. This mindset helps build better relationships.

15. “That’s not fair.”

Life isn’t always fair, and mature people know this. When someone frequently complains about fairness, it signals a lack of emotional growth. Recognizing that fairness is subjective helps build resilience. Mature individuals focus on what they can control rather than dwelling on perceived injustices.
